New York Times*bestselling author April Henry delivers*a thrilling murder mystery featuring a teen with an assassin on her trail fighting to uncover the truth behind a government cover up, perfect for fans of Karen McManus.

Sometimes, the only way to live is to make sure the world thinks you're dead . . .*

In the aftermath of a car accident that claimed the life of her senator father, sixteen-year-old Milan finds herself adrift, expelled from her third boarding school. Milan's mother, who has assumed the senate seat, diverts her private plane to pick up her daughter. But on their way home, a bomb rips off a wing and the plane crashes in the mountains. In her final moments, Milan's mother entrusts her with a key. She reveals it will unlock the evidence that so many people have already died for-including Milan's father. The only way Milan can survive, her mom tells her, is to let everyone believe she died with the other passengers.

¿Milan is forced to navigate a perilous descent in freezing conditions while outwitting everything from a drone to wild animals. With relentless assassins on her trail, she must untangle the web of deceit and save herself and countless others. Will she piece together the truth in time?

School Library Journal

05/03/2024

Gr 9 Up—Sixteen-year-old Milan has been kicked out of yet another boarding school—her third in the six months since her dad, Senator Jack Mayhew, died in a car accident. Her mom, who has since been elected to her husband's senate seat, has to detour her private plane to pick Milan up in Colorado. As the plane is flying over Oregon's Cascade Mountains on its way to Portland, disaster strikes. An explosion sends the aircraft plummeting towards the snow-covered peaks. Her mother survives just long enough to tell Milan that her dad's death and the plane crash weren't accidents. They were assassinations. Her mom insists that if Milan wants to live she needs to "stay dead." In turns, the novel follows the stories of Milan, Lenny, her would-be assassin, and Janie, a dairy farmer who leased her land to Prospect Power for natural gas extraction (commonly called fracking). The cat-and-mouse between Milan and Lenny adds a thick layer of tension, especially as Lenny closes in on her target. While Janie's story can feel contrived, it does provide necessary background on fracking and things come together nicely as the climax looms. Most characters cue white. VERDICT Perfect for fans of What Beauty There Is by Cory Anderson or Be Not Far From Me by Mindy McGinnis.—Katie Patterson
